How to Find a Private Psychiatrist in the UK
Finding the ideal mental health care specialist can be a complicated task, especially when considering private psychiatry. The UK uses a varied series of mental health services, however lots of individuals seeking treatment frequently prefer the tailored approach that private psychiatrists provide. This article will guide you through the steps required to find a private psychiatrist in the UK, what factors to consider, and responses to regularly asked concerns.
Understanding Private Psychiatry
Private psychiatry describes mental health care services supplied by professionals who run outside the National Health Service (NHS). Patients who pick private psychiatry private practice typically seek quicker access to visits, a more comprehensive option of professionals, and numerous treatment choices that may not be offered through public services.
Benefits of Private Psychiatry
- Minimized Waiting Times: Patients often experience substantially shorter wait times for consultations.
- Flexible Scheduling: Appointment times can be more accommodating to the patient's needs.
- Personalized Care: Patients might have more chances for individually time with their psychiatrist.
- Access to Specialists: Availability of a broader series of specializeds and treatment approaches.
Actions to Find a Private Psychiatrist
The process of discovering a private psychiatrist includes a number of essential actions. The following guide details these actions in information:
1. Determine Your Needs
Before you begin searching for a psychiatrist, it's crucial to understand what you require. Consider the following:
- Type of Therapy Needed: Are you looking for medication management, psychotherapy, or both?
- Expertise: Some psychiatrists concentrate on specific areas, such as stress and anxiety disorders, depression, ADHD, or injury.
- Preferred Treatment Methods: Some experts may integrate alternative therapies or prefer evidence-based medication, so it's important to know what you're searching for.
2. Research Study Potential Psychiatrists
Conduct extensive research study to put together a list of possible psychiatrists. Here are some resources to think about:
- Online Directories: Websites like the Royal College of Psychiatrists, Therapy Directory, or Psychology Today can provide listings of certified psychiatrists in your location.
- Word of Mouth: Recommendations from household, buddies, or other healthcare professionals can lead you to trusted psychiatrists.
- Insurance coverage Providers: If you have private health insurance coverage, check which psychiatrists are covered under your strategy.
3. Examine Qualifications and Experience
As soon as you have a list, it's essential to confirm each candidate's qualifications. Look for:
- Medical Qualifications: Ensure that the psychiatrist is registered with the General Medical Council (GMC) and belongs to a professional body, such as the Royal College of Psychiatrists.
- Experience: Review their experience in treating your specific condition.
- Patient Reviews: Online reviews or reviews can supply additional insights into the psychiatrist's technique and effectiveness.
4. Arrange an Initial Consultation
A preliminary assessment can assist you identify if a psychiatrist is the right suitable for you. Throughout this visit, think about:
- Comfort Level: Do you feel comfy discussing your issues?
- Communication Style: How does the psychiatrist discuss treatment alternatives? Is the communication clear and encouraging?

5. Examine Costs and Payment Options
Private psychiatric services can vary significantly in cost. Clarify the following with your chosen psychiatrist:
- Consultation Fees: Understand the expenses for the first appointment and any follow-up sessions.
- Payment Methods: Inquire about accepted payment techniques and if they offer payment plans.

6. Ongoing Assessment
When you've started treatment, it's essential to frequently examine your development. Track:
- Improvements: Are you observing any favorable modifications in your mental health?
- Treatment Satisfaction: Are you pleased with the care you are receiving? You should feel comfy attending to any issues with your psychiatrist.
Table: Factors to Consider When Choosing a Private Psychiatrist
| Aspect | Description |
|---|---|
| Specialization | Focus areas such as stress and anxiety, depression, or trauma recovery. |
| Experience | Years in practice and experience with your particular condition. |
| Payment Options | Service costs, payment approaches, and insurance coverage. |
| Consultation Approach | Design of communication and convenience level throughout consultations. |
| Availability | Flexibility of consultation scheduling and location of practice. |
Frequently Asked Questions
1. How do I know if I need to see a psychiatrist?
If you are experiencing persistent symptoms affecting your life, such as serious state of mind swings, anxiety, depression, or changes in behavior, it might be time to consider speaking with a psychiatrist.
2. Can I self-refer to a private psychiatrist?
Yes, people can self-refer to private psychiatrists without requiring a recommendation from a GP, which is often required for NHS services.
3. Will my insurance cover the costs of a private psychiatrist?
Numerous private health insurance prepares deal coverage for professional psychiatric services, but it's crucial to examine your particular policy information.
4. What can I expect throughout my first appointment?
Throughout the first consultation, you can expect to discuss your symptoms, personal history, treatment objectives, and any concerns you might have regarding the treatment procedure.

5. The length of time will I require to see a psychiatrist?
The duration of treatment differs extensively depending on the person's needs and the complexity of their condition. Regular continuous assessments will assist determine the continued necessity of sessions.
